Congo reports attack on Ebola burial team as cases rise
KINSHASA, June 4 - Residents attacked an Ebola burial team in eastern Democratic Republic of Congo's South Kivu province this week, forcing responders to abandon a coffin and raising fears of further transmission, the health ministry said.
